Role of batch size in scheduling optimization of flexible manufacturing system using genetic algorithm
Abstract Flexible manufacturing system (FMS) readily addresses the dynamic needs of the customers in terms of variety and quality. At present, there is a need to produce a wide range of quality products in limited time span. On-time delivery of customers’ orders is critical in make-to-order (MTO) ma...
